Practical Tips for Using Seamless Repeating Patterns
To make the most of these digital assets, it's important to understand how to apply them effectively:
- Use Layer Masks in Design Software: Tools like Adobe Photoshop or Canva allow you to blend the pattern with other elements subtly. A layer mask can help you reveal only parts of the pattern where needed, keeping your composition clean.
- Pair with Complementary Colors: Since the patterns often feature neutral or earthy tones, try adding vibrant accents like gold foil, deep blues, or emerald greens to highlight focal points.
- Experiment with Transparency: Adjusting the opacity of the pattern can prevent it from overwhelming your design. A semi-transparent layer adds texture without stealing attention from text or images.
- Combine with Textures: Overlaying the pattern with parchment, linen, or aged paper textures can give your project a more authentic feel. This technique is especially useful for historical or fantasy-themed content.
- Test Print Sizes: Before printing large quantities, test the pattern at different scales to ensure it maintains clarity and visual appeal. High-resolution PNGs are great for this, but results depend on the printer and material used.

Staying Original While Leveraging Themes
With so many pre-made patterns available, it’s crucial to maintain originality in your work. One way to do this is by blending multiple Castlecore patterns together in a collage format. Another method is to overlay your own artwork or photography on top of the pattern, allowing it to complement rather than dominate the piece.
You can also modify the patterns digitally before using them. Try changing the color palette to match your branding or mood, or add your own hand-lettered titles and illustrations. The goal is to let the pattern enhance your message without overshadowing it.
